The Company in Focus: Harvestance

Harvestance, a design and engineering services company, specializes in additive manufacturing. They provide 3D printing design solutions (DfAM) and services across various industries, including automotive, semiconductors, footwear and food tech. Harvestance has received numerous inquiries for the design and manufacture of customized, lightweight, and strong grippers for collaborative robots, aimed at automating production lines.

At a glance:

  • 80% Weight Reduction

  • Delivery times reduced from weeks to days

  • New line of products developed

  • Custom, lightweight, affordable grippers

  • Automated Production Systems with Digital Forge

  • Outsourcing costs eliminated
